Output 41a7c1cea603d3e74298660209d625b3dc0bfe5c76c13bc4a03ea9e86ddac672:16

value
21067991
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f70c0bed6036b737ced3fe7d55cd189a0a3c9576 OP_EQUALVERIFY OP_CHECKSIG
address
LhkDbc9y7Ad2XL94eCLW1wEqPZUEB9R3Zo
transaction
41a7c1cea603d3e74298660209d625b3dc0bfe5c76c13bc4a03ea9e86ddac672
spent
true